You could probably maximize your time in Cairo with a tour, but it is definitely doable on your own. We spent two days on our own there last month and did a ton! Saw the pyramids, visited the Egyptian Museum, Islamic Cairo, the big market, felucca ride, the Citadel...more info and pics in our Cairo post at http://patrinadoestheglobe.blogspot.com/
